Joseph H. Martin III, 80, passed away Sunday, December 3rd after a period of declining health. Mr. Martin leaves his wife Louise A. (Couture) Martin. He was born in Upton and was the eldest son of the late Joseph H. Martin, Jr. and Eliza Jean (Strachan) Martin. Mr. Martin had lived in both Milford and Ashland moving to Shrewsbury in 1982. He was a summer resident at his cottage in Dennisport. Mr. Martin was Chief Expeditor at Fenwal Inc. in Ashland prior to his retirement in 1987. He had worked at Fenwal for more than 35 years. Prior to that Mr. Martin had been employed by Fish Hat Corp. of Framingham, William Knowlton Hat Co. of Upton, Herman Shoe and Porter Shoe, both of Millis. Mr. Martin was a 1943 graduate of St. Mary's Academy of Milford. He was a decorated WW II Army veteran serving with the 64th Field Artillery Battalion, 25th Infantry Division, 6th Army in the Asian-Pacific Theater of operations on Luzon in the Phillipines. He was awarded the Phillipines Liberation Medal, two Battle Stars and other ribbons. Mr. Martin was a charter member of Post 2331 VFW in Ashland and the Fenwal Quarter Century Club. He was also a social member of the Columbus Club in Framingham. Besides his wife, Mr. Martin leaves a son, Joseph H. Martin, IV of Mashpee; a step daughter Lillian Leno of Richmond, VA; two grandchildren, Matthew and Bryana McGillycuddy of Suffren, NY; one sister, Nancy Jean Basciano of Niles, OH; and two brothers, Colonel James A. Martin of North East, MD and John Martin of Upton.
